As a Restaurant General Manager (RGM), you will lead the operation of our restaurants, ensuring they meet GPS Hospitality standards of quality, service, and cleanliness. You will not work in isolation; instead, you will collaborate closely with a dedicated team of managers to drive success.
This role is designed for a leader who thrives in a high-volume setting and is committed to operational excellence. You will be responsible for the overall performance of the restaurant, including hitting sales and profit budgets, executing accurate projections, and maintaining rigorous safety and accounting controls. A key part of your day involves working all shifts—including breakfast, lunch, dinner, late night, and weekends—to stay connected with the team and the guest experience.
Beyond daily operations, you will serve as a vital link to the community, developing and improving the restaurant's public relations through frequent contact with the public, local businesses, and community organizations. You will also play a crucial role in talent development, training and coaching service-obsessed crew, shift leaders, assistant managers, and manager trainees to ensure a pipeline of future leaders.
Interested candidates should ensure they meet the core requirements, including 3-5 years of General Manager experience in a restaurant or retail setting, a valid driver's license, and authorization to work in the US. Those with a High School Diploma or GED and ServSafe certification are preferred.
